Liverpool include Jarrell Quansah buy-back clause
Liverpool have inserted a buy-back clause in the £35million deal to send Jarrell Quansah to Bayer Leverkusen.
Fabrizio Romano reports that the clause is worth more than £51m and can be triggered from 2027 onwards.
Quansah is expected to complete his switch to Germany after England's Under-21 Euros defence.

Adam Lallana announces retirement
Former Liverpool midfielder Adam Lallana has announced his retirement from professional football, ending a 19-year career.
Lallana made 305 Premier League appearances for the Reds, Brighton and Southampton and earned 34 England caps.
The 37-year-old left Southampton at the end of his second spell at the club earlier this summer and has now called it quits.

Arsenal set to confirm signing this week
Arsenal are expected to complete the signing of Kepa Arrizabalaga from Chelsea this week, reports BBC Sport.
The Spaniard has a £5million release clause in his contract at Stamford Bridge, and the Gunners are keen to acquire his services and have the 30-year-old be a second-choice option behind David Raya.
Kepa spent last season on loan at Bournemouth, replacing Neto – who was coincidentally loaned to Arsenal.

United join race for £34m midfielder
Manchester United have reportedly spoken with the representatives of Club Brugge star Ardon Jashari.
AC Milan are pushing to strike a deal for the midfielder, but the Mirror report that the Red Devils have also expressed an interest in acquiring his services – but the 22-year-old has not yet warmed to the idea of joining Ruben Amorim’s side.
Jashari has also rejected advances from Fulham and West Ham.
Brugge are demanding a £34million package to sell the playmaker this summer, with Milan opening the bidding with an offer worth £25.6m.
